In order to be a contract, the agreement must include valid consideration. That is, both parties must contribute a Quid pro quo to the agreement such as money, labor, a return promise, etc. To form a valid contract, both parties must have the legal capacity to enter into a contract and the purpose or objective of the contract must be legal.
